V + 9<br> ---------- = 8 <br> 3<br><br> Can someone help me ??
bagirrra123 [75]
\frac{v + 9}{3} = 8

Multiply both sides by 3, because 3 is our denominator (bottom number in a fraction), and we want to get rid of the denominator.

3 × (v + 9) = 8 × 3

Simplify.

3v + 27 = 24

Then, subtract both sides by 27.

3v = 24 - 27

Simplify.

3v = -3

Divide both sides by 3.

v = -1

What is the length of the shadow cast by a 12-foot lamp post when the angle of elevation of the sun is 60º? (to the nearest tent
elena-s [515]

Answer:

6.9 foot.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given: Length of lamp post= 12-foot.

           The angle of elevation of the sun is 60°.

∴ The length of Lamp post, which is opposite is 12-foot.

  Now, finding the length of shadow cast by foot lamp.

Length of shadow is adjacent.

∴ We know the formula for Tan\theta= \frac{Opposite}{adjacent}

Next, putting the value in the formula.

⇒ Tan 60° = \frac{12}{adjacent}

Cross multiplying both side and using the value of Tan 60°

∴ Adjacent= \frac{12}{\sqrt{3} } = 6.92 ≅ 6.9 (nearest tenth value)

6.9 is the length of shadow cast by a 12-foot lamp post.
